There are a number of ways to set up menus, depending upon your reasons. One way is to use multi-depth drop down suckerfish menus, like I've done on this website: http://www.winterssewing.com It has both the top drop-down menu (based on the primary menus) as well as a side menu. It uses the Marinelli theme. Another example of multi-depth drop down suckerfish menus is shown here on this website: http://www.upholsteryresource.com , which uses the NewsFlash theme. Both of these themes have built-in drop-down suckerfish menus. There are also other themes with built-in drop down OR suckerfish menus. I've noticed that themes that have the built-in drop down menus look better (to me) than using a theme without the menus and having to add a dropdown menu module.
